Removal And Installation: Removal

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2022 Chrysler Voyager and 2022 Chrysler Pacifica.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
NOTE:

If a NEW  Security Gateway (SGW) module is being installed, use the diagnostic scan tool to flash the module. Failure to flash the module will leave the SGW module in a locked mode preventing SGW module operation.

  1. Disconnect and isolate the negative battery cable. If equipped with an Intelligent Battery Sensor (IBS), disconnect the IBS connector first before disconnecting the negative battery cable.
  2. Remove the Integrated Center Stack (ICS). Refer to MODULE, INTEGRATED CENTER STACK (ICSM), RE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ION .
    GC0183801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
    NOTE:

    The Security Gateway (SGW) module is mounted to the Instrument Panel (IP) on a bracket behind the shifter assembly and Integrated Center Stack (ICS).

  3. Remove the three retaining bolts and disconnect the SGW module wire harness connectors.
  4. Remove the SGW module (1) from the vehicle.
